- 博客(9)
- 资源 (8)
- 收藏
- 关注
转载 linux常用基本命令
Linux中许多常用命令是必须掌握的,这里将我学linux入门时学的一些常用的基本命令分享给大家一下,希望可以帮助你们。这个是我将鸟哥书上的进行了一下整理的,希望不要涉及到版权问题。1、显示日期的指令: date2、显示日历的指令:cal3、简单好用的计算器:bc怎么10/100会变成0
2015-09-18 10:17:52 446
转载 Bash编程七大展开之参数展开(Parameter Expansion)
1. ${parameter} 取parameter的值2. ${parameter:-word} 如果parameter为空,则用word的值做parameter的缺省值3. ${parameter:=word} 在2的基础上,把word的值赋给parameter4. ${parameter?=word} 如果parameter为空,word作为错误信息输出。5. ${param
2015-09-17 17:34:27 1081
转载 《linux 内核Makefile》之$(CURDIR)/Makefile Makefile: ;
这是一条"空指令",Makefile中使用它来阻止make使用隐含规则构建指定目标。make 在执行时,需要一个命名为Makefile 的文件。在一个完整的Makefile 中,一般包含了5部分:规则(显示指定和隐含规则)、变量定义(同样包含显示变量和隐含变量)、指示符( include, define 等)和注释。显 示规则是由作者显示写出的规则,而隐含规则则是内建在make 中,为ma
2015-09-08 22:59:57 6293 1
转载 makefile中的注释
$(Q)@:Q=或者Q=@那么这句就是 @: 或者@@: 其实都是一样的 @:解释一下:makefile里面命令前加@表示不显示源命令。试试就可以了。加多个和加一个的效果是一样的。:是bash的内建命令,效果就是就是什么都不做, 并且总是返回状态0. (命令可以带参数)所以总体来说 $(Q)@: 就是什么都不做。如果后面有参数。等同于注释掉。
2015-09-04 15:37:25 9115 1
转载 Makefile中include、-include、sinclude
include、-include、sinclude使用本节我们讨论如何在一个 Makefile 中包含其它的 makefile 文件。Makefile 中包含其它文件的关键字是“include”,和 C 语言对头文件的包含方式一致。 “include”指示符告诉 make 暂停读取当前的 Makefile,而转去读取“include”指定的一个或者多个文件,完成以后再继续当前
2015-09-04 11:35:16 17578
转载 makefile相同目标的合并之问题
target1: dep1target1: dep2 cmd2这种情况下,这两个相同的target1会被合并成 target1: dep1 dep2 cmd2但如果第一条规则本身也带一个命令的话, makefile就无法合并, 给出警告,并用后面的规则替代前面的规则 targ
2015-09-04 10:37:27 1346
转载 Makefile 中:= ?= += =的区别
在Makefile中我们经常看到 = := ?= +=这几个赋值运算符,那么他们有什么区别呢?我们来做个简单的实验新建一个Makefile,内容为:ifdef DEFINE_VRE VRE = “Hello World!”elseendififeq ($(OPT),define) VRE ?= “Hello World! First!”endifif
2015-09-03 10:04:34 372
转载 uboot之Mkconfig分析
uboot的官网可以通过谷歌搜索得到,显示结果第一个链接就是。官网::http://www.denx.de/wiki/U-Bootftp下载:ftp://ftp.denx.de/pub/u-boot/本文以uboot 2014.07为例,一般第一步总是类似这样:make smdkc100_config然后执行make先看Makefile第481 行%
2015-09-02 19:14:19 2512
转载 awk 用法
awk 用法:awk ' pattern {action} ' 变量名 含义 ARGC 命令行变元个数 ARGV 命令行变元数组 FILENAME 当前输入文件名 FNR 当前文件中的记录号 FS 输入域分隔符,默认为一个空格 RS 输入记录分隔符 NF 当前记录里域个数 NR 到目前为止记录数 OFS 输出域
2015-09-02 18:27:20 345
猪哥的嵌入式Linux公房菜
2017-10-14
产品设计与开发(第三版)
2017-10-14
PID 调节控制做电机速度控制
2017-10-14
Software Engineering for Embedded Systems
2017-06-05
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人